Adopting a rescue pup is not only a noble act of compassion, but it also comes with numerous lifesaving benefits for both the dog and the adopter. First and foremost, many rescue organizations are filled with animals that have been abandoned or neglected, and by bringing one of these fur babies into your home, you are literally saving a life. According to various studies, shelter dogs often exhibit remarkable gratitude and loyalty towards their new families, resulting in a deep emotional bond that enriches the lives of both the pet and the owner. This profound connection can lead to lower stress levels, increased happiness, and a sense of purpose, ultimately benefiting your overall health.
Moreover, adopting a rescue pup contributes positively to your community and the environment. By choosing to adopt rather than shop for a pet, you are helping to reduce the number of animals that overcrowd local shelters. Each adoption not only clears space for another dog in need but also helps combat the overpopulation crisis in animal shelters. Additionally, rescue pups often come with vaccination and health checks, making them a responsible choice for prospective pet owners. In conclusion, the lifesaving benefits of adopting a rescue pup extend far beyond the act itself; they foster companionship, promote community welfare, and advocate for the humane treatment of animals.
